Gymnastics' Servidio Named ECAC Gymnast of the Week

2.13.18 | Women's Gymnastics

Danbury, Conn. - The Eastern College Athletic Conference has announced this week's edition of its Division I women's gymnastics awards, naming freshman Monica Servidio Gymnast of the Week. The honor comes after a first place all-around performance at Penn with Bridgeport and Ursinus.

In just her second time competing all-around for the Owls, Servidio earned a career-high 9.8 floor score, a 9.7 balance beam score, a 9.75 uneven bars score, and a 9.725 vault score to post a 38.975 all around. The freshman placed first out of four all-arounders at the Palestra on Sunday.

Servidio's 9.8 career-best contributed to Temple's 49.050 team floor score – the second highest in program history. Her 38.975 stands as the second highest all-around score posted in the ECAC so far in 2018. Servidio has the conference's No. 1 all-around scoring average.

On Saturday Feb. 17, Temple Gymnastics will host Bridgeport, West Chester, and Ursinus for the annual Ken Anderson Invitational in McGonigle Hall at 1 p.m.
